A BILL TO BE ENTITLED

AN ACT

relating to the authority of certain counties to impose a hotel

occupancy tax.

B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:

SECTION 1. Section 352.002, Tax Code, is amended by adding

Subsection (ii) to read as follows:

(ii)

The commissioners court of a county that borders

Oklahoma and is bisected by United States Highway 62 may impose a

tax as provided by Subsection (a). A tax imposed under this

subsection does not apply to a hotel located in a municipality that

imposes a tax under Chapter 351 applicable to the hotel.

SECTION 2.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ives

a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as

prov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this

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this

Act takes effect September 1, 2025.
